How Does Laser Fat Removal Technology Work for Belly Fat?
Laser fat removal technology operates by delivering controlled laser energy to targeted fat cells beneath the skin’s surface. The process typically involves low-level laser therapy that creates small pores in fat cell membranes, allowing the stored fatty contents to leak out. This mechanism, known as lipolysis, causes fat cells to shrink significantly without damaging surrounding tissues.
During treatment, specialized laser paddles or applicators are placed directly on the skin over the belly area. The laser energy penetrates approximately 9 millimeters into the subcutaneous fat layer, where it disrupts the cellular structure of fat cells. Once the fat contents are released, the body’s lymphatic system naturally processes and eliminates these fatty acids through normal metabolic pathways.
Most laser fat removal systems operate at specific wavelengths, typically between 635-680 nanometers, which have been clinically shown to be most effective for fat cell disruption. The entire process is painless, with many patients describing the sensation as simply feeling warm during the 20-30 minute treatment sessions.
What Are the Benefits of Non-Surgical Approaches to Stomach Fat Removal?
Non-surgical laser fat removal offers numerous advantages over traditional liposuction and other invasive procedures. The most significant benefit is the complete absence of incisions, anesthesia, or recovery downtime. Patients can typically return to their normal activities immediately following treatment sessions.
Safety represents another major advantage, as laser fat removal carries minimal risk of complications compared to surgical alternatives. There’s no risk of infection, scarring, or adverse reactions to anesthesia. The targeted nature of laser technology also means that surrounding skin, muscles, and organs remain completely unaffected during treatment.
The gradual nature of results often appears more natural than dramatic surgical changes. Most patients begin noticing improvements within 2-4 weeks, with optimal results visible after 6-12 weeks as the body continues processing the released fat. Additionally, many laser fat removal systems can treat multiple body areas simultaneously, making it possible to address belly fat along with other problem areas in a single session.
Cost-effectiveness also makes non-surgical approaches attractive to many patients. While multiple sessions may be required, the total investment often proves less expensive than surgical procedures when considering all associated costs, including anesthesia, facility fees, and recovery time.

Preparing for Your Laser Fat Removal Journey
Success with laser fat removal often depends on proper preparation and realistic expectations. Candidates should maintain stable weight and good overall health before beginning treatment. Most practitioners recommend staying well-hydrated and following a balanced diet to support the body’s natural fat elimination processes.
Pre-treatment consultations typically include body composition analysis and medical history review to determine candidacy. Patients should disclose any medications, medical conditions, or previous cosmetic procedures to ensure safety and optimize results.
Setting realistic expectations is crucial, as laser fat removal typically achieves modest but noticeable improvements rather than dramatic transformations. Most patients can expect 2-4 inch reductions in treated areas, with results varying based on individual factors such as age, metabolism, and treatment compliance.
